ND milk production in 2nd quarter down from 2011

FARGO, N.D. (AP) — Milk production in North Dakota during April, May and June totaled 86 million pounds, down 2 percent from the second quarter of 2011.

The Agriculture Department says the average number of milk cows during the three months was 18,000. That was unchanged from the first quarter of this year but down 1,000 head over the year.
